Living stocks of the pathogen can be preserved utilizing one particular of four approaches. Alternatively, leaf disks with fresh sporangia can be stored at –70°C in sealed plastic boxes for 1 to four months with out loss of viability (Virányi 1985). A third process makes use of sporangia suspended in water containing 15% DMSO, which enables storage at –20°C for up to 6 months without loss of virulence . Long-term storage can be achieved under liquid nitrogen by suspending sporangia in 15% dimethyl sulfoxide as originally described for Peronosclerospora sorghi (Breese et al. 1994 Gale et al. 1975). Most parasites could infect only a couple of species of host organisms, or a group of closely related species. Bd, nevertheless, is unusual in that it appears to be able to infect any of the far more than 8000 known species of amphibian—even if the severity of the infection may well differ extensively among those species.

You could possibly not realize it, but you’re surrounded by spores, both indoors and outdoors.

Fungal spores are typically present in low concentrations indoors unless sources of indoor growth are present. Lacking such growth, the indoor fungal microbiome depends largely on dispersal from the outdoors. Outdoor and indoor air surveys are applied to recognize the fungal genera present in different geographic areas. Skin prick test research of sufferers with allergic respiratory disease have identified the frequency of good skin test responses to several fungal allergens. Lower temperatures (5-10°C) significantly delay the infection cycle, taking two-3 instances longer than at 20°C, with each delayed symptom expression and diminished spore production. At temperatures above 25°C, infection and sporulation are halted. Fungicide application in this case was as well late to provide productive head protection.
